Papua New Guinea is making strides in new energy storage initiatives. A recent tender has been opened for the development of a hybrid solar minigrid system that includes a solar and battery energy storage system on the island of Buka1. Additionally, the country is prioritizing solar energy, with ongoing construction of a solar farm in Buin, reflecting a broader shift towards renewable energy2. These efforts are part of a larger strategy to enhance energy access and sustainability in the region. [pdf]

The Oneida Energy Storage Project is a 250MW/1,000 MWh advanced stage, stand-alone lithium-ion battery storage project, representing one of the largest clean energy storage projects in the world. [pdf]
